Output 12391c4780238218a26b6b5a5e4bcdc6c67ab705b177d097de14dc49bb2c7e0e:0

value
1769027
script pubkey
OP_0 OP_PUSHBYTES_20 5ec0d0186d104d949f189a4ddcb62587f8ae91ff
address
bc1qtmqdqxrdzpxef8ccnfxaed39slu2ay0lhqrwwf
transaction
12391c4780238218a26b6b5a5e4bcdc6c67ab705b177d097de14dc49bb2c7e0e